When planning your trip to Byron Bay, there are several practical tips to keep in mind. First, the nearest airport is Ballina Airport, located about 18 miles away, which offers regular shuttle services to Byron Bay. You can book these shuttles online for convenient door-to-door transport. If you're arriving by train, a shuttle train service operates between Byron Bay station and North Beach station, covering a distance of about 1.9 miles. For getting around the area, there's a local shuttle service that runs on a rehabilitated section of the Murwillumbah line, making it easy to explore. Additionally, be aware that traffic can get congested during school holidays, especially on Ewingsdale Road, so consider alternative routes if you're traveling during peak times. Lastly, Byron Bay has a laid-back vibe, so casual dress is the norm, and while tipping isn't customary, rounding up your bill or leaving small change is appreciated in service settings. Packing sun protection is also advisable, as UV levels can be high, particularly in summer.
